Physically consistent mesoscale model evaluation in complex terrain

open access: yesQuarterly Journal of the Royal Meteorological Society, Volume 152, Issue 775, January 2026 Part B.
This study introduces a novel approach for evaluating mesoscale atmospheric models in complex terrain by selecting physically consistent grid points and applying height‐based corrections. The method corrects for sensor height and terrain elevation differences between model and observations using a time‐varying lapse rate.
